Check your Pressure and also Temperature Level Valves


Your hot water heater's temperature as well as pressure shutoffs regulate the temperature level and also pressure within the hot water heater container. These valves will protect against an explosion if your container gets also hot or if the stress exceeds risk-free degrees.
Sadly, these safety and security devices provide no caution when they go bad. You can validate your valve's efficiency by hanging on to the valve's bar. If it remains in good condition, water ought to spurt. If no water flows out or only a drip is launched, rush and obtain your valves dealt with.

Scan for fire threats.


As you check your valves, provide its environments an once over. Scan the area for fire risks, particularly if you make use of a gas-powered water heater.
First, check for combustible products like fuel, gas tanks, as well as various other heat-generating devices. Next, check for little bits of paper as well as timber, including trash. Do not get rid of your garbage near your hot water heater tools.
You would do well to keep any type of clothing much from your hot water heater. Ought to a fire begin, these products will certainly promote its spread. That said, your laundry line ought to not be close to your water heater.

Always preserve appropriate air flow.


If your hot water heater isn't appropriately aired vent, it'll lead fumes right into your residence. This can cause respiratory issues and also give you cough or an allergy.
A good vent ought to face up or have a vertical slant, leading the smoke away from the household. If your air vent does not follow this style, it might be a setup error.
You need a plumber's assistance to repair bad water heater ventilation.

Show your household how to switch off the water heater.


Throughout this excursion, show your family exactly how to turn off the heating unit, especially if it is a gas heating system. They must also recognize when to transform it off. For example, if there is a gas leakage, if the water stress drops also reduced, or if the water heater is overheating. You need to likewise switch off your water heater when you'll be away for a couple of days, as well as when the tank is vacant.

Constantly predetermined the optimum temperature level.


Hot water burns in the house are common. You can protect against accidents, conserve power and respect the atmosphere simply by presetting your hot water heater's maximum temperature level. The most convenient warm water temperature is 120F. Water at this temperature level is safe for grownups, children, and also the elderly.

Tips to Increase the Lifespan of your Water Heater


Turn OFF the geyser when not in use


Turn the geyser off when you are done using it. It will help decrease power consumption, extend lifespan, and save money on water heater repair. The water does not turn cold, even after switching the geyser off, as the storage tank holds the temperature of the water for 4-5 hours.


Proper Installation


Proper space should be left around the water heater. It should not feel crowded, and giving room to breathe increases airflow and reduces the risk of fires. This gives you optimal space for completing routine system maintenance checks without difficulty. Nothing should be kept near or under the geyser. The geyser should be installed away from wet areas, like the bathtub, shower, or toilet.


Insulate your Water Heater


Insulation should be installed around the pipes and the water heater to make it more energy efficient and to increase the water temperature by 2-4 degrees. During the summertime, this keeps the pipes from sweating or forming condensation. It can also protect your cold water pipes from freezing and potentially bursting during cooler months. Insulation may cut heat loss by as much as 45% and your expenditures for overheating the water.


Replace the Sacrificial Anode


Water heaters are equipped with a sacrificial anode to prevent corrosion by hard water. The anode rod protects the tank from rusting on the inside and should be checked yearly. Without a rod or a properly functioning anode rod, the hot water quickly corrodes inside the tank. It can last anywhere from five to ten years. However, the amount of water you use and the hardness of your water determines its need for replacement.


Install a Water Softener


f you live in an area where the mineral content is high in the water systems, then installing a water softener might help expand the lifespan of your water heater. When an area has high mineral content (calcium and magnesium) in the water, it’s known as hard water. Hard water leaves deposits to form at the bottom of the water heater, which causes them to have problems much sooner than expected. To prevent this from happening, install a water softener that filters out the minerals that make the water hard, allowing only soft water to flow through the pipes.


Lower the Temperature


Lowering the temperature of your geyser will help you save electricity, increase its life, and the geyser will have to work less. Maintaining a temperature of 120 degrees Fahrenheit to eradicate the vast majority of pathogens is a good thumb rule. The hotter your hot water supply is, the more energy it will consume.
